Today's we announce the new 2025-2026 Texas State University Feature Twirlers!


Texas State University, located in San Marcos, TX, is the home of the "Pride of the Hill Country" - the Bobcat Marching Band. Annually, the BMB selects twirlers to serve in their feature positions. Auditions were held this spring, and three twirlers were selected to represent Texas State for Fall 2025!

Returning to the Bobcat Marching Band for her senior season will be Hollyn Flemings-Stumpand new to the TXST Jim Wacker field will be incoming freshmen, Brooklyn Maxwell & Olivia Crisp!


 
Brooklyn Maxwell is and incoming freshman from Kilgore, Texas, where she was a majorette for all four years and served as Head Twirler her senior year. She is coached by Janice Jackson Seamands, and her most notable title was the 16-year-old National Show Twirl Champion. 

We asked Brooklyn what brought her to Texas State, and she told us it was a mix of the campus and the band program. "I have seen multiple videos of the pregame and halftime performances of the Texas State BMB and I loved the band atmosphere I felt, and I loved the uniqueness of the band running out on the field and their unique moves in their drill. I also love the campus. It is just the right size, and it is absolutely gorgeous. Kaylee Williams, a former TX State feature twirler was a student of my coach a few years back and I loved watching her twirl. She talked to me about Texas State a few years ago and I loved getting to hear about her stories at Texas State and how much she loved it there! I am so excited to continue my twirling career at Texas State. I am so thankful and blessed that I was given this position and I can’t wait for all of the amazing memories I am going to make with Olivia and Hollyn. I cannot wait to twirl with them. Go Bobcats!"



Olivia Crisp is and incoming freshman from New Braunfels, Texas, where she was the Feature Twirler at Canyon Lake High School. She is a member of the Twirling Sweet Sensations where she is coached by Michele Pangrac, and this year she had the honor winning the Senior Beginner Southwest Regional Pageant. 

We asked Olivia what brought her to Texas State, and she said attending a game her Junior year was the moment she knew it would be a great home away from home. "I wanted to twirl at Texas state because I loved the campus and the community. I had the opportunity to see a TXST football game my junior year of high school and I felt like I could really picture myself on that field, ultimately leading to my determination to get this role as feature twirler!"


Returning Feature Twirler, Hollyn Fleming-Stump, is from Melissa, Texas, and is excited for her senior season!


We look forward to seeing these three talented young ladies as they lead the Pride of the Hill Country and are featured at halftime in the Bobcat Stadium. Congrats to Holly, Brooklyn, and Olivia! Eat 'Em Up Cats!
